Definition

A family of massively parallel, high-throughput DNA sequencing technologies that produce large volumes of short to long reads from nucleic acid libraries, enabling genome-scale, transcriptome and targeted analyses at scale.

Definition

High‑throughput DNA sequencing technologies that parallelize the sequencing of many DNA molecules to produce large volumes of nucleotide reads for genomic and transcriptomic analyses; includes diverse chemistries and platforms that differ in read length, error profile and throughput.
